I would recommend doing ANYTHING YOU CAN to graduate high school! Less than 1/3 of teen mothers graduate. I actually dropped out of HS before I got prego--- thus leading on the path that caused the prego lol. But I am determined to graduate college and I have one little one. Only 5% or less of high school mommies get their bachelor degrees and its a huge goal of mine.
I have a lot of support from bf so he helps me when it comes to school work. Also, I do know mothers who were in highschool and their parents were the main reason why they were able to finish. Some highschools have childcare in school if you have any there- that might help.
Some highschools also offer night classes. If you cant find childcare during the day--- and I think that still gets you your diploma.
